Customer Reviews of SMC DVD330S DVD Player
Watch out for hidden VCR hazard! I bought this DVD player in April of 2001. I bought it mainly because at the time, I ordered a lot of movies from England. I hooked it up to my TV, had no problems. Well, then the batteries started going out quickly. But I have another remote that does this, too, so I started taking the batteries out when not in use. When I moved, I had to hook it up through the VCR. It worked fine until 2 weeks ago when the remote died. No battery changes bring it back. So I contacted SMC.
The man I spoke to today said they'd discovered two years ago that the video protection inside the DVD player, which apparently is meant to prevent recording DVDs onto VHS, sends a signal back to the remote, and it makes the remote not work. If it is that way for too long, the remote dies. He said they stopped making them in 1999, and sold their quantities as is w/no warranties to larger companies who may or may not have opted to give a warranty.
When the remote worked, this was a great product. Just be careful. It will cost you [money]to get a new remote, if they happen to have any in stock. If the remote doesn't work, you cannot change regions or TV systems.

Great multi-region player.
This is a very versatile multi-region DVD player that also plays VCD's and CD-R/RW's. It also plays back PAL system VCD's and DVD's on NTSC TV's. It has a full function remote control.
The only drawback is that there is a visible jitter while moving from one layer to another during the playback of playing multi-layered DVD's.
